Stone paper is a new type of material between paper and plastic. From the perspective of replacing the traditional part of paper, it can save a lot of forest resources for the society and reduce the secondary pollution generated in the papermaking process; from the perspective of replacing the traditional part of plastic packaging, it can save a lot of strategic resources for the country. . However, some experts questioned whether it can be truly degraded. As a new thing, stone-based paper is moving forward in controversy.


What is stone paper?

Stone paper is also called stone paper. It is mainly sourced from limestone mineral resources with large reserves and wide distribution (calcium carbonate content reaches 70~80%), and high-molecular polymers (content 20~30%) are used as auxiliary materials. The polymer interface chemistry and the characteristics of polymer modification are processed by a special process and made by polymer extrusion and blow molding processes. It is a variety of processed paper. Stone paper has the same writing performance and printing effect as plant fiber paper, and at the same time has the core performance of plastic packaging.
